First, As the Nation gets ready to say its final goodbye to former President Jimmy Carter, a conversation with Stuart Eizenstat, Carter’s chief White House domestic policy adviser and the author of “President Carter: The White House Years." Next, Henry Olsen of the Ethics and Public Policy Center discusses his recent New York Post op-ed in which he argues Donald Trump's White House win signals a historic "realignment" favoring the Republican party. Plus, Investigative journalist Dave Levinthal discusses his reporting into who is contributing large sums of money to President-elect Trump's inaugural committee - and why.
